Move website from subdomain to main domain
-
I’ll try to be clear but I am no developper nor a master in website management so I might struggle a bit to explain my goal. Well.
So I have a WordPress website hosted at godaddy.com. I own two domains, lejustemilieu.ca which is my main domain and another one (subdomain I think), work.lejustemilieu.ca.
At the root of my website (public_html), I got my old website version files. I can still access that old site through lejustemilieu.ca. In that folder, I got another folder (work) in which I have installed my new website to which I can access though work.lejustemilieu.ca. So, I kind of understand that this makes my new website being installed on a subdomain of my main domain.
Now, I would like to move my new site one level up so it is actually installed at the root of the server, making it accessible directly via my main domain. I other words, I would like to change the root directory of my main domain.
If I go to my admin Cpanel/Domains and do Manage on my main domain it is said that I can’t manage the domain nor change it’s document root.
What would be the clean way to move my website? I’ve tried changing the WordPress website address through the WordPress admin interface and moving the files manually but of course it causes a server error. I guess this is pretty normal as a result but I don’t know what to do otherwise.The page I need help with: [log in to see the link]
